Sto Len's performance offered an immersive auditory experience, connecting a microphone to a tree branch and a bowl of water. The resulting sounds channeled the essence of the temple's natural topography. This performance highlighted the relationship between natural elements and artistic expression, capturing the sacred connection between the environment and the artist. Len's work emphasized the transient and ephemeral nature of existence, using natural elements as instruments for reflection. The simplicity of Len's setup allowed participants to focus on the subtleties of sound and the profound stillness of the temple grounds.
